what is the best way to embed passwords in python scripts?
I am wanting to automate tasks that would typically require credentials.
I've been looking into keyring and this works great when you run the script from Command line in windows.
but in WSL it makes you type in a master pass which stinks for automated scripts (cron/scheduled tasks).
pyKeePass looks pretty cool and it works well. I was thinking about using a keepass database then compile the Python script using Pyinstaller so the master pass would be "hidden".
i would prefer to use keyring and just make it to where I don't have to type in the master pass
